Former WWE star Bishop Dyer (Baron Corbin) has won another gold medal, this time at the Jiu-Jitsu World League Florida XII tournament. On Twitter, Dyer noted that he had just three days of training going in due to a recent eye injury, yet still came away with the win. Dyer is currently signed to MLW and is one-half of the MLW World Tag Team Champions with Donovan Dijak. Added another gold to the collection today!!! #subcity pic.twitter.com/WAWC…
